发明名称 Systems and methods for stack-jumping between a virtual machine and a host environment
摘要 Several embodiments of the present invention provide a means for reducing overhead and, thus, improving operating efficiency in virtualized computing systems. Certain of these embodiments are specifically directed to providing a bypass mechanism for jumping directly from a first stack in the guest operating system to a second stack in the host operating system for a virtual machine environment. More specifically, certain embodiments of the present invention are directed to a system for and method of eliminating redundancy in execution of certain virtual machine commands and executing host environment equivalents by using bypass mechanisms, thereby bypassing redundant software layers within the guest and host stacks. For some of these embodiments, the bypass mechanism operates at a high-level component of the stack or, alternatively, the bypass mechanism operates at a low-level component of the stack.
申请公布号 US2006005186(A1) 申请公布日期 2006.01.05
申请号 US20040882504 申请日期 2004.06.30
申请人 MICROSOFT CORPORATION 发明人 NEIL MIKE
分类号 G06F9/46 主分类号 G06F9/46
代理机构 代理人
主权项
地址